WebJul 19, 2016 · Place the hurdles (about 6 inches high) 5 meters apart. Jumpers should emphasize high knees as they clear (or take off at) each … WebMay 24, 2024 · If the average distance is 60 feet, place a marker 60 feet from the front of the takeoff board to begin the approach. Remember that a strong head or tail wind can affect the approach. For example, if you’re running with the wind, back up your starting spot a bit. WebSep 15, 2024 · Bend your body so your upper torso is parallel with the floor. Hold your arms at your sides and extend them straight back so they’re also parallel with the floor. When you’re ready, lift your body and propel yourself into a jump. Raise both of your arms up and over your head. Land with both feet flat on the floor.
